New book introduces a statistic gamechanger for ecologists

Spatio-Temporal Models for Ecologists is out today, February 26, and now allows readers to learn how TMB can be used in marine research to run complex mathematical models in minutes that would previously take days.

National Institute of Aquatic Resources
National Institute of Aquatic Resources (DTU Aqua) conducts research, provides advice, educates at university level and contributes to innovation in sustainable exploitation and management of aquatic resources. We investigate the biology and population ecology of aquatic organisms, aquatic physical and chemical processes and ecosystem structure and dynamics, taking account of all relevant natural and anthropogenic drivers.
